Output d7928925e2e247dc36a13a0d8379286156add27a1481d208d6146f99bcc69174:0

value
38395000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8888d85cd5490f5e27ec70c34989655f467a278d OP_EQUAL
address
MLM64grdff7ojV6waazWfaQNked5R4XtKm
transaction
d7928925e2e247dc36a13a0d8379286156add27a1481d208d6146f99bcc69174
spent
true